What factors are most important for making accurate MLB predictions?
Accurate MLB predictions hinge on several factors, including team performance metrics (like run differential and record against winning teams), player health and injury reports, and the impact of trades made at the deadline. Understanding a team's pitching depth, offensive consistency, and defensive capabilities is crucial. Also, analyzing managerial strategies and the team's recent performance trends can provide valuable insights for forecasting future outcomes.
How do injuries affect MLB predictions?
Injuries can significantly impact MLB predictions, especially if they involve key players. The loss of a star pitcher or a power hitter can weaken a team's chances of winning games and making the playoffs. Analyzing the team's depth and their ability to replace injured players is essential. Teams with strong depth are often better equipped to weather injury storms and maintain their competitiveness.
